[ ] Set up the guest Wi-Fi desk at Halloway Court reception. Confirm the tablet is charged, the laminated joining instructions are displayed facing visitors, and the spare network cards are stocked in the drawer. Test one voucher yourself before opening. The drawer stays locked at all times when unattended; to open it during your shift, use the facilities pass code printed below.

staff pass of kagef-yahip = bdg-TKELFT-63915354

**Q: The roof-terrace door keeps jamming — what do I tell people?**

Yeah, it's the wind pressure on level 7, not their badges. Tell them to push firmly near the handle, not the glass. If it still won't budge, log it with facilities and send them up via the fire stairs, using the code below.

turnstile pass: bdg-R-53

## Authentication

Matchbox (the pairing service) exposes GC pause metrics at `/internal/gc`. Pauses over 400ms page on-call. The endpoint is behind the Kestrelgate proxy; anonymous calls return 403. Auth is a static service key in the `X-Matchbox-Key` header — no OAuth, no refresh. Keys rotate quarterly; stale keys fail closed, which looks identical to a network partition, so check auth first. The current on-call key for the GC metrics endpoint is below.

API key for kahap-faduf: vxb23-Ir087IkWYmBJt7KRtkyhUA3